首页 »Javascript教程 » javascript函数:JavaScript验证函数集合 »正文javascript函数:JavaScript验证函数集合来源: 发布时间:星期五, 2008年11月14日 浏览:126次 评论:0
* **************************************************** 功 能:验证函数集合 说 明: 版 本:1.0 作 者: 创建时间:2007-8-31 *************************************************** */ <!-- //禁止输入空格 function forbidSpace() { //onkeypress="forbidSpace();" if (window.event.keyCode==32) { alert('不允许输入空格!'); window.event.keyCode = 0x0; } } //去除字符串空格 function trim(s) { return s.replace(/(^\s+)|(\s+$)/g,""); } //表单项是否为空 function IsEmpty(pstr) { //alert(pstr) if (trim(pstr).length == 0) { return true; } return false; } //比较两个表单项的值是否相同 function IsRepeat(obj1, obj2) { if ((obj1).value != (obj2).value) { return false; } return true; } //比较两个数值大小 function CompairNum(value1,value2) { var ret; ret=eval(value1-value2); if(ret>0 || isNaN(value1) || (value1.charAt(0)==0 && !isNaN(value1.charAt(1)) && value1.charAt(1)!='') ) { alert('输入有误!'); return false; } return true; } //比较两个数值大小 function CompairNum2(value1,value2,note) { var ret; //alert(value1); ret=eval(value1-value2); if(ret>0 || isNaN(value1) || (value1.charAt(0)==0 && !isNaN(value1.charAt(1)) && value1.charAt(1)!='') ) { alert(note); return false; } return true; } //百分数[数字 . %] function percentage() {// 37 - %; if(!(window.event.keyCode>47&&window.event.keyCode<58||window.event.keyCode==46||window.event.keyCode==37)) { window.event.keyCode=0x0; } } //身份证[数字 x] function identityCard() { if(!(window.event.keyCode>47&&window.event.keyCode<58||window.event.keyCode==120)) { window.event.keyCode = 0x0; return false; } return true; } //格式必须仅为数字0-9 function _disibledevent=0) return true; return false } 0
相关文章
读者评论
发表评论 |